ELDER ANTIQUE AND CLASSIC AUTOMOBILES 114 SOUTH NEW STREET, STAUNTON, VIRGINIA, U.S.A. 24401 540-885-0500VADLR 1979 Chevrolet Camaro Z28 2Dr Sport Coupe 108” Wheelbase 350 C.I.D. / 175 Horsepower V-8 Engine Chevrolet Motor Division General Motors Corporation Detroit, Michigan, U.S.A. V.I.N.: 1Q87L9N512114 Mileage: 35, 823(Indicated) Engine Codes and Numbers: Code: (350 C.I.D. V-8 4 bbl. 175 HP, Automatic) V.I.N.: (Chevrolet, Camaro Sport Coupe, 350, 1979, Built at Norwood, Ohio, Car# 412114) Data Plate: Style: 79-1FQ87 (1979 Camaro Sport Coupe) Body: N 030449 Trim: 24N (Bucket Seat Trim, Blue) Paint: 11 (White, Refinished in Daytona Blue) Code: 10B (2nd Week of October, 1978) Accessory Codes: A31 (Power Windows) Z28 (Z28 Sport Coupe) Base price when new: $6,115.35 Weight: 3,505 Pounds Production: 282,571 (1979 Chevrolet Camaro) Production: 84,877 (1979 Chevrolet Camaro Z28) Optional Equipment: AK1 Color-keyed Seat Belts, A01 Soft Ray Tinted Glass, All Windows AU3 Power Door Locks, B37 Color Keyed Front and Rear Floor Mats G80 Limited Slip Differential, C49 Rear Window Defogger CD4 Controlled Cycle Windshield Wipers, D55 Console MX1 Automatic Transmission, N33 Tilt Steering Wheel U05 Dual Horns, Z54 Interior Décor / Quiet Sound Group Overview: Originally finished in White, this car has been professionally refinished in Corvette Daytona Blue with brand new factory Z/28 graphics, and it presents an exquisite visual appeal. The interior has also been reupholstered in blue fabric and custom diamond stitched inserts. The car retains it's 350 cubic inch engine and Rochester Quadrajet carburetor, but has had some top end work done such as valves, cam, Edelbrock aluminum intake and Accel electronic ignition. It has a stall converter and custom exhaust, including headers. We have extensive documentation of all work that has been completed on the car.
